What is noise cancellation in earphones?

Noise-cancelling headphones are headphones that reduce unwanted ambient sounds using active noise control. Noise cancellation makes it possible to listen to audio content without raising the volume excessively. It can also help a passenger sleep in a noisy vehicle such as an airliner.

What does noise isolating mean?

Passive Noise Cancellation
Noise isolation, a.k.a “Passive Noise Cancellation”, is the act of blocking noise through the use of physical barriers. Just as you hear less noise when you cover your ears with your palms, noise isolation in headphones achieves the same result by forming a secure seal using the foam pads in the ear cups.

Is krisp noise Cancelling free?

Is Krisp free? Yes, Krisp provides a free plan that gives you 120 minutes per week of free usage for filtering your own microphone. You get 120 minutes per week for muting the speaker’s noise as well.

Which is better noise Cancelling or noise isolating?

Noise-cancelling earbuds work wonders for drowning out low decibel ambient noise, like car and airplane engines, and air conditioners, making them generally more effective than noise-isolating only listening accessories.

Is it possible to create a noise free environment?

Building a completely noise-free environment just for running tests and measurements is seldom a practical solution. Fortunately, simple devices and techniques such as using proper grounding methods, shielded and twisted wires, signal averaging methods, filters, and differential input voltage amplifiers can control the noise in most measurements.
